JS外链文件编写及最佳实践详解43


在现代Web开发中,将JavaScript代码分离到外部文件中是一种最佳实践。这不仅可以提高代码的可维护性、可重用性和组织性,还可以提升页面加载速度,改善用户体验。本文将详细讲解如何编写和使用JS外链文件,并分享一些最佳实践,帮助你更好地掌握这项技能。

一、创建JS外链文件

创建JS外链文件非常简单,你只需要使用任何文本编辑器(如Notepad++、Sublime Text、VS Code等)创建一个新的文件,并使用`.js`作为文件扩展名即可。例如,你可以创建一个名为``的文件。

在文件中,你可以编写任何有效的JavaScript代码。以下是一个简单的例子:
//
("Hello from external JavaScript file!");
function greet(name) {
("Hello, " + name + "!");
}
greet("World");

这段代码定义了一个名为`greet`的函数,并调用它来输出问候信息。你可以根据你的需求在这个文件中编写更复杂的代码,例如创建对象、处理事件、发送AJAX请求等等。

二、链接JS外链文件到HTML页面

创建完JS外链文件后,你需要将其链接到你的HTML页面。这可以通过在HTML文件的``或``部分使用``标签来实现。推荐将``标签放在``的底部,这样可以避免阻塞页面渲染。

以下是如何在HTML文件中链接``文件:



External JavaScript Example






在这个例子中,`src`属性指定了JS外链文件的路径。如果``文件与HTML文件位于同一目录下,则可以使用相对路径,如上面的例子所示。如果``文件位于其他目录下,则需要使用完整的路径或相对路径,确保浏览器可以正确找到文件。

三、多个JS外链文件的加载顺序

如果你的项目需要多个JS外链文件,你需要注意它们的加载顺序。浏览器会按照``标签出现的顺序加载JS文件。如果一个文件依赖于另一个文件,则必须确保依赖的文件先被加载。例如,如果``依赖于``,则必须先加载``,然后加载``:



四、使用模块化提高代码组织性

对于大型项目,建议使用模块化来组织你的JavaScript代码。模块化可以提高代码的可重用性和可维护性。可以使用ES模块或CommonJS模块来实现模块化。ES模块是现代JavaScript的标准模块系统,使用`import`和`export`关键字来导入和导出模块。

例如,``:
//
export function greet(name) {
("Hello, " + name + "!");
}

然后在另一个文件中导入并使用:
//
import { greet } from './';
greet('World');

五、最佳实践

为了编写高质量的JS外链文件,以下是一些最佳实践:
使用有意义的文件名: 文件名应该清晰地反映文件的内容。
代码压缩和混淆: 在生产环境中,可以使用工具(如Webpack、Rollup)来压缩和混淆JS代码,减少文件大小,提高加载速度,并保护代码。
代码规范: 遵循一致的代码风格和规范,例如使用代码格式化工具(如Prettier),提高代码的可读性和可维护性。
错误处理: 在代码中添加错误处理机制,例如使用`try...catch`语句来捕获和处理异常。
注释: 为代码添加清晰的注释,解释代码的功能和逻辑。
代码测试: 编写单元测试来验证代码的正确性。
版本控制: 使用Git等版本控制系统来管理代码,方便协作和回滚。

六、结语

正确地编写和使用JS外链文件是构建高效、可维护的Web应用程序的关键。通过遵循以上建议和最佳实践,你可以有效地组织你的JavaScript代码,提高开发效率并改善用户体验。 记住,随着项目规模的增长,良好的代码组织和模块化设计变得至关重要。

2025-04-24


上一篇:JS外链文件编写详解:从基础到进阶,助你轻松掌握

下一篇:相册外链流量限制:如何突破瓶颈,高效分享你的精彩瞬间